Description
***NO ONWARD CHAIN*** Situated within a highly desirable development in Lower Earley, this well-presented two double bedroom end of terrace home offers spacious and versatile accommodation, ideal for first-time buyers, professionals, or investors alike. Upon entering the property, you are welcomed by a bright entrance hall with a convenient cloakroom. This leads through to a generous lounge, providing an excellent space for relaxing and entertaining. To the rear, a spacious kitchen offers ample storage and worktop space, with direct access into a charming conservatory overlooking the private rear garden, perfect for enjoying views across the seasons. Upstairs, the property boasts two well-proportioned double bedrooms. The principal bedroom benefits from its own en-suite shower room, while a modern family bathroom serves the second bedroom. Externally, the property enjoys a pleasant outlook to the rear, facing the attractive Carnival Fields. To the front, there is driveway parking and a garage, which has been thoughtfully divided to provide a useful home office space, ideal for remote working. Conveniently located, the property offers excellent access to the M4 and A329 motorways, providing superb links to Reading, Bracknell, and London.
